Sweet and Sour Chicken: Powdered peanut butter (which you’ll find on the nut butters aisle) adds richness here; if you’d rather not use it, sub more flour. Find plum sauce in the Asian foods section.
Hands-on Time: 23 Mins
Total Time: 23 Mins
Yield: Serves 4 (serving size: 1/2 cup rice, about 1 cup chicken mixture, 1 tablespoon cilantro, and 1 1/2 teaspoons sesame seeds)
Ingredients
- 1/4 cup mirin (sweet rice wine) or 1/4 cup dry sherry mixed with 2 teaspoons sugar
- 1 large egg, lightly beaten
- 1 pound skinless, boneless chicken breast tenders, cut into (2-inch) pieces
- 1/4 cup powdered peanut butter
- 3 tablespoons quick-mixing flour (such as Wondra)
- 3 tablespoons cornstarch
- 1 tablespoon sugar
